	.tophdr{
	font-family: Verdana, Arial, sans-serif;
	font-weight: bold;
	font-size: 10px;
	background-color: #4a1400;
	color: #ffffff;
	}
	
	.tophdr A {COLOR:ffffff; text-decoration:none}
	.tophdr A:visited {COLOR:ffffff; text-decoration:none}
	.tophdr A:hover {COLOR:ffffff;  text-decoration:underline}
	
	
	.boxhdr{
	font-family: Verdana, Arial, sans-serif;
	font-weight: bold;
	font-size: 10px;
	background-color: #D9A573;
	color: #000000;
	}

	.boxContent {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	background-color: #FFFDEF;
	}	

	.boxContentSml {
	font-family: Georgia,Trebuchet MS,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	background-color: #FFFDEF;
	}		

	
	.bullet {
	list-style-image: url(/dining/files/images/bullet.gif);
	}

	
	
	.boxBorder{
	background-color: #DCDCDB;
	color: #ffffff;
	}	
	
	
	.standard,ul,li,td,p,body {
	font-family: Georgia,Trebuchet MS,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	}
	

	
	
	
	
	

	.aText {
	color: #666666; 
	font-family:verdana,arial,lucida,sans-serif; 
	font-size:10px
	}
	//.standard,ul,li,td,p,body {
	//color: #000000; 
	//font-family:verdana,arial,lucida,sans-serif; 
	//font-size:12px
	//}






	.even_row{
	font-family: Verdana, Arial, sans-serif;
	font-size: 12px;
	background-color: #ebf5ff;
	}








		.leftNavOff {
			MARGIN-TOP: 2px; FONT-SIZE: 11px; MARGIN-BOTTOM: 2px; COLOR: #003366; LINE-HEIGHT: 12px; FONT-FAMILY: Arial, Helvetica, sans-serif; TEXT-DECORATION: none

		}

		.leftNavOn {
			background-color: #EAEFF3; MARGIN-TOP: 2px; FONT-WEIGHT: bold; FONT-SIZE: 11px; MARGIN-BOTTOM: 2px; COLOR: #003366; LINE-HEIGHT: 12px; FONT-FAMILY: arial, helvetica, sans-serif; TEXT-DECORATION: none
		}
		
		.leftNavOnOld {
			background-color: #EAEFF3;
			color: #990000; font-family:arial,helvetica,sans-serif; font-size:10px; text-decoration:none;
			cursor:pointer; cursor:hand;
		}
				

		.menu_arrow {position: relative; }
		.even_row_old {background-color:  #EAEFF3 }
		
		.oddRow {background-color:  #FFFFFF }
		
		.lineMarker {background-color: #6B7194; }
			
		.productHeader	{color: #000000;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old}			
			
		.Heading2	{background-color: #EAEFF3; MARGIN-TOP: 2px; FONT-SIZE: 11px; MARGIN-BOTTOM: 2px; COLOR: #003366; LINE-HEIGHT: 14px; FONT-FAMILY: arial, helvetica, sans-serif; TEXT-DECORATION: none}
		.Heading1	{MARGIN-TOP: 2px; FONT-SIZE: 11px; MARGIN-BOTTOM: 2px; COLOR: #003366; LINE-HEIGHT: 16px; FONT-FAMILY: arial, helvetica, sans-serif; TEXT-DECORATION: none}
			
		.blackFontHeader	   {color: #000000; font-family:verdana,arial,lucida,sans-serif; font-size:18px; font-weight: bold}
		
		.topNav
		{
		  font-weight: bold;
		  font-size: 12px;
		  color: #ffffff;
		  font-family: verdana,arial,lucida,sans-serif;
		  background-color: #336699;
		  text-decoration: none;
		}

		.topNavOn
		{
		  font-weight: bold;
		  font-size: 10px;
		  color: #ffffff;
		  font-family: verdana,arial,lucida,sans-serif;
		  background-color: #003366;
		  text-decoration: none;
		}
		
		.topNavOff
		{
		  font-weight: bold;
		  font-size: 10px;
		  color: #003366;
		  font-family: verdana,arial,lucida,sans-serif;
		  background-color: #ccd6e0;
		  text-decoration: none;
		}				

		.leftNavHeader
		{
		  font-weight: bold;
		  font-size: 14px;
		  color: #000000;
		  font-family: verdana,arial,lucida,sans-serif;
		  background-color: #ffffff;
		  text-decoration: none;
		}			
		.menu_spacer {background-color: #6B7194; }				
		
		
		.menu_arrow {position: relative; }
		

		
		.menu_child_normal {
			color: #666666; font-family:arial,helvetica,sans-serif; font-size:10px; text-decoration: none;
			cursor:pointer; cursor:hand;
		}

		.menu_child_selected {
			background-color: #EAEFF3;
			color: #990000; font-family:arial,helvetica,sans-serif; font-size:10px; text-decoration:none;
			cursor:pointer; cursor:hand;
		}
		.menu_parent_expanded, .menu_child_expanded {
			background-color: #EAEFF3;
			color: #990000; font-family:arial,helvetica,sans-serif; font-size:10px; text-decoration:none;
			cursor:pointer; cursor:hand;
		}
		
		.menu_child_expanded_autohide {
			background-color: #EAEFF3;
			color: #990000; font-family:arial,helvetica,sans-serif; font-size:10px;
		}
		
		.menu_child_selected_autohide {
			background-color: #EAEFF3;
			color: #990000; font-family:arial,helvetica,sans-serif; font-size:10px;
		}
		.menu_header {color: #666666; font-family:arial,lucida,sans-serif; font-size:11px; font-weight:bold; text-decoration: none; text-transform:uppercase;}
		
		.gray_sub_header {
			font-family: Arial,sans-serif;
			font-size: 14px;
			color: #313131;
			font-weight: bold;
		}
		
		.gray_text {
				font-family: Arial,sans-serif;
				font-size: 12px;
				color: #313131;
				line-height: 1.5;
			}
		
